Blewett has won a<br \/>\nrace at Stafford in each of the last two seasons and has been in contention<br \/>\nfor victory in each of the Whelen Modified Tour\u2019s first two visits of the<br \/>\n2010 season.  Blewett finished second to Bobby Santos in the May TSI<br \/>\nHarley-Davidson 125 and finished 15th in the CARQUEST Tech-Net Spring<br \/>\nSizzler after hitting the wall on the final lap of the race while running in<br \/>\nthe top-3.<!--more--><br \/>\n\u201cI always enjoy coming to Stafford, it\u2019s one of my favorite tracks,\u201d said<br \/>\nBlewett.  \u201cWe\u2019re coming back with the same car and engine combination that<br \/>\nwe\u2019ve had two strong runs at Stafford with so far.  At the Sizzler, that was<br \/>\njust hard racing at the end of the race, and then in May, we had a flat tire<br \/>\nwhile we were racing with Bobby [Santos] for the win.  I\u2019ve never come to<br \/>\nStafford with the same setup twice in the car until this year.  We had a<br \/>\nstrong run at the Sizzler and we\u2019ve tweaked on the car a little since then,<br \/>\nbut we\u2019re working off of the same base setup and we\u2019re looking forward to<br \/>\nanother strong run.  I wish I could have run this well in the SK at<br \/>\nStafford.\u201d<br \/>\nBlewett\u2019s strong efforts at Stafford this season come as a continuation of<br \/>\nsuccess at the Nutmeg half-mile for the New Jersey native.  Blewett won the<br \/>\nTown Fair Tire 150 two years ago and last year he led 97 of 101 laps en<br \/>\nroute to taking the checkered flag in the TSI Harley-Davidson Classic.<br \/>\nBlewett knows what it takes to reach victory lane at Stafford and he hopes<br \/>\nto parlay that strategy into a visit to victory lane for the third<br \/>\nconsecutive season.<br \/>\n\u201cWe\u2019re going to go with the same strategy we\u2019ve been using at Stafford,<br \/>\nwhich is be patient at the start of the race and try to get into the top-5<br \/>\nor top-3 to be a contender for the win at the end of the race,\u201d said<br \/>\nBlewett.  \u201cStafford is a track that you can win a race at either by taking<br \/>\ntires or by staying out and not taking tires.  Going into the race our plan<br \/>\nis to go the whole race without pitting, but that can change with track<br \/>\nposition, what the leader does, and where we are in the race.\u201d<br \/>\nIn addition to his track knowledge and car setup, Blewett says that there is<br \/>\nanother factor at Stafford that helps him get to the front.<br \/>\n\u201cI love the fans at Stafford,\u201d says Blewett.  \u201cWhenever we come to Stafford,<br \/>\nthere always seems to be more excitement from the fans than the other tracks<br \/>\nthat we go to.  If you run well at Stafford, they appreciate your effort<br \/>\nthat much more.
